SouthFlorida.com recommends the 1939 Wuthering Heights as a lovey-dovey film for these days of Cupids and hearts.

Wuthering Heights (1939): An atmospheric production of Emily Bronte's brooding love story of the Yorkshire moors, with Laurence Olivier as the wild and passionate Heathcliff and Merle Oberon as his tragic love, Cathy Earnshaw. The pairing results in one of the screen's most persuasive and bittersweet romances. The tempestous Olivier dominates the film, and the fragile Oberon makes the perfect foil.

Among others, the list also contains "Titantic" (sic). Ha.

There's also a poll asking "which big-screen romantic hero would you like to sweep you off your feet?" but Heathcliff is not even an option!
